Abstract:This study aims to identify the effectiveness of farmer group associations (Gabungan Kelompok Tani) in empowering the farming community in Kampung Jaya Makmur, Kurik District. The research employs a descriptive qualitative…
ve approach. Data were collected through interviews, observations, and documentation. The study analyzes organizational effectiveness based on four indicators: Human Relations (focusing on organizational involvement), Open System Model (adaptation and innovation), Internal Process Model, and Rational Goal Model (productivity and goal achievement). The results show that in Kampung Jaya Makmur, the head of the farmer group association has never conducted socialization or training for farmer groups on how to produce or provide natural fertilizers using locally available materials, despite the uncertainty of continuous fertilizer supply. The effectiveness of farmer group associations in empowering the community is highly needed to support farmers in becoming more independent. Farmer group associations can provide services such as access to technological information and capital, as well as establish partnerships with external parties. This study recommends that farmer group associations strengthen participation and member involvement through more regular deliberation forums and active engagement of all levels of farmers. It also emphasizes the need to enhance the use of technology and alternative agricultural methods, such as organic fertilizers, and to expand training and mentoring programs so that farmers can reduce their dependence on chemical fertilizers.

Abstract:The use of the phrase “sit with Me on My throne” has long been debated among scholars regarding whether it should be understood literally or symbolically. Textual analysis of Revelation 3:21 shows that the word “sit” (kathízō,…
t” (kathízō, καθίζω) carries an important meaning in the Book of Revelation. It not only refers to the physical act of sitting but also contains a symbolic aspect: participation in divine authority and governance. This study applies the historical-grammatical method of exegesis to explore the true meaning of this phrase and its relevance to the spiritual life of Christians today. This method focuses on the historical and grammatical context of Revelation 3:21. The findings show that Christ’s promise to those who overcome is not merely about future heavenly honor but also an invitation to share in His mission, authority, and glory. The phrase signifies the restoration of identity and covenantal fellowship between Christ and the victorious believers. It reflects Christ’s exaltation by the Father and shows that the “throne” is not only a symbol of power but also a theological image of shared rule and divine communion. This study affirms that the concept of “sitting with Christ” offers both eschatological hope and present spiritual empowerment. The theology of victory in Revelation encourages perseverance and faithfulness, placing believers within the narrative of divine triumph. Thus, this study contributes to a deeper understanding of New Testament eschatology, Christian discipleship, and the believer’s role in God’s redemptive plan. Revelation 3:21 is a message of promise, restoration, and identity where participation in Christ’s reign is both a future hope and a present reality.

Abstract:Cultural-based tourism has become an important strategy for enhancing community welfare while preserving local cultural heritage. Desa Tua in Buleleng Regency, Bali, possesses significant potential through the bamboo weaving…
ving tradition of the Bali Aga community, which holds substantial economic and cultural value. This study aims to analyze community empowerment through the development of tourism based on cultural weaving products, strengthen the bargaining position of local artisans, and examine efforts to maintain a balance between economic benefits and cultural preservation. The study employed a mixed-methods approach with a sequential explanatory design and involved 150 respondents. Data were collected through observation, interviews, documentation, and surveys. The findings reveal that experiential tourism increased average household income by 35% and enhanced women's participation by 42% through their involvement in production activities, training programs, tour guiding, and the management of creative enterprises. Traditional weaving products were successfully developed as the primary tourism attraction, generating greater economic value while preserving cultural integrity through the clear distinction between sacred and commercial products. The utilization of digital media further expanded market access and strengthened product competitiveness. The novelty of this study lies in the development of an integrative model that connects community empowerment, experiential tourism, cultural preservation, women’s empowerment, and digital cultural entrepreneurship as a sustainable strategy for cultural tourism development.
Abstract:Panglipuran Village, Bali, is one of the traditional tourism villages with significant potential to support the economic independence of local communities. However, community empowerment in this village faces various challenges,…
llenges, such as limited resources, a lack of community capacity in management, and dependence on external parties. This study aims to analyze community empowerment based on local participation through the management of the tourism village, using the community empowerment theory proposed by Jim Ife. The study emphasizes the importance of resource, opportunity, knowledge, and skill indicators in supporting the success of community empowerment. This research employs a qualitative descriptive method, collecting data through in-depth interviews, field observations, and documentation. The primary informants of the study include community leaders, local business actors, and tourism village managers. The findings reveal that empowerment through resource indicators has increased the income of craft businesses by 150%, from IDR 2 million to IDR 5 million per month. Furthermore, the opportunity indicator successfully opened avenues for the community to manage homestays, increasing income by up to 70% compared to previous levels. The knowledge and skill indicators also proved significant, with more than 90% of the community actively participating in training, which supports the sustainable economy of the tourism village. The conclusion of this study highlights that community empowerment based on local participation has a positive impact on the economic independence of the Panglipuran Village community. The novelty of this research lies in the integration of community empowerment elements with local wisdom values, such as mutual cooperation and cultural preservation. This model contributes not only to economic development but also serves as a best practice example in sustainable local participation-based tourism village management.
